Transaction 3e7d2a25df51059ca399195fa807bde7733db9da0dc4eeb74d061e1e2175b796
1 Input
2 Outputs
- 3e7d2a25df51059ca399195fa807bde7733db9da0dc4eeb74d061e1e2175b796:0
- 3e7d2a25df51059ca399195fa807bde7733db9da0dc4eeb74d061e1e2175b796:1
value 74358705
address 1DbUtcPoGTeFHRLtKLvva8DpQy2TAJeqLN
value 74169742
address 38fiWHsrnnFj6Mqciq7C9MPoHR5jztNSxq